Overview

Ek-VCK190-G from AMD (Xilinx) is a Versal™ AI Core Series evaluation kit built around the production-grade VC1902 adaptive SoC, delivering 100× greater AI and DSP compute versus server-class CPUs for high-throughput inference and signal processing prototyping in cloud, network, and edge systems.

For engineers reviewing the EK-VCK190-G datasheet, pinout, applications, or equivalent options, this kit supports PCIe Gen4 host interface, HDMI video I/O, SFP28/QSFP28/RJ-45 networking interfaces, DDR4/LPDDR4 memory, and FMC expansion - enabling rapid validation of AI-accelerated data paths, 5G DFE, radar beamforming, and ADAS sensor fusion architectures.

Technical Context

The EK-VCK190-G integrates the Versal VC1902 device featuring AI Engines (AI Engine-ML), programmable logic (PL), and Arm® Cortex®-A72 application processors, co-optimized for heterogeneous compute workflows. It supports real-time AI inference with hardware-accelerated quantization, INT8/INT16/BF16 arithmetic, and low-latency streaming via AXI-Stream and PL-to-PS interconnects.

Development is fully enabled by Vivado™ ML Edition for RTL and system integration, Vitis™ unified software platform for C/C++/Python acceleration, and Vitis AI for model compilation, quantization, and deployment to AI Engines and programmable logic - all validated on the physical board with pre-built partner reference designs.

Key Specifications

ParameterValue and Actual Design Meaning
Core DeviceVersal VC1902 AI Core series adaptive SoC - production silicon with 1.2M+ logic cells, 400 AI Engines, and dual-core Cortex-A72.
PCIe InterfacePCIe Gen4 x16 root port - enables high-bandwidth host CPU offload and direct memory access for AI workload streaming.
Video I/OHDMI 2.0 transmitter (TX) - supports 4K@60fps output for real-time video analytics pipeline validation.
Networking InterfacesSFP28 (28 Gbps), QSFP28 (100 Gbps), and RJ-45 (1 GbE) - allows flexible PHY layer testing for 5G fronthaul, cable head-end, and test equipment.
Memory SubsystemDDR4 (up to 32 GB, 2400 MT/s) + LPDDR4 (4 GB, 4266 MT/s) - dual-channel support enables concurrent AI model loading and real-time buffer management.
ExpansionFMC+ (VITA 57.4) and FMC (VITA 57.1) connectors - accept industry-standard mezzanine cards for RF, ADC/DAC, optical, or custom I/O extension.

Manufacturer

Advanced Micro Devices, Inc. (AMD), following its acquisition of Xilinx, develops adaptive computing platforms combining FPGA fabric, scalar processors, and domain-specific accelerators for AI, networking, and embedded applications.

The EK-VCK190-G belongs to the Versal AI Core Series evaluation platform line, designed specifically to accelerate AI inference, wireless signal processing, and real-time sensor fusion in cloud, telco, and automotive development environments.

FAQ

What is the primary purpose of the EK-VCK190-G evaluation kit?

The EK-VCK190-G is a production-ready evaluation platform built around the Versal VC1902 AI Core series adaptive SoC. Its primary purpose is to enable rapid prototyping and performance validation of AI inference, 5G digital front-end (DFE), radar beamforming, and ADAS sensor fusion workloads using real silicon, supported by Vivado ML, Vitis, and Vitis AI toolchains.

Does the EK-VCK190-G include pre-programmed firmware or reference designs?

Yes, the EK-VCK190-G ships with a pre-programmed System Controller SD card and includes multiple pre-built partner reference designs - such as 5G DFE, video analytics, and radar processing examples - accessible via the Vitis AI and Vitis software platforms to accelerate time-to-first-design on the EK-VCK190-G.

Which memory interfaces are supported on the EK-VCK190-G board?

The EK-VCK190-G supports DDR4 (up to 32 GB, 2400 MT/s) and LPDDR4 (4 GB, 4266 MT/s) memory interfaces, both directly connected to the VC1902 SoC. These interfaces are used for high-bandwidth AI model storage, real-time frame buffering, and low-latency system memory access during EK-VCK190-G evaluation.

Can the EK-VCK190-G be used for PCIe-based host acceleration applications?

Yes, the EK-VCK190-G features a PCIe Gen4 x16 root port interface, allowing it to operate as a high-performance accelerator card in x86 or Arm-based host systems. This enables direct integration into data center servers or test benches for AI inference offload, packet processing, or custom hardware acceleration using the EK-VCK190-G.

What networking connectivity options does the EK-VCK190-G provide for 5G and cable-access applications?

The EK-VCK190-G provides SFP28 (28 Gbps), QSFP28 (100 Gbps), and RJ-45 (1 GbE) interfaces - supporting fronthaul/backhaul validation, DOCSIS 4.0 head-end processing, and wireless test equipment development. These interfaces are electrically and mechanically validated for use with standard optical modules and PHY devices on the EK-VCK190-G.
